M. F. Husain was an Indian painter who was one of the most celebrated and internationally recognized Indian artists of the 20th century. He was a modernist and a figurative painter known for his bold use of color and expressionistic style. He was also a printmaker, photographer, and filmmaker, and was often referred to as the "Picasso of India". Following is our collection on famous quotes by M. F. Life Lessons by M. F. Husain
- M. F. Husain's work demonstrates the importance of experimentation and pushing boundaries in art, as he often combined traditional Indian painting techniques with modernist styles.
- His work also celebrates the diversity of Indian culture and its vibrant colors, as seen in his bold and expressive use of color and form.
- Lastly, Husain's work serves as a reminder to appreciate the beauty of nature, as many of his works depict scenes from rural India.
